Working TogetherYou bring the topic, and we explore it together. I ask real questions, listen closely, and reflect back what I'm hearing until things get clear. The insights that stick are the ones you arrive at yourself, in your own words. Then we turn them into action: one clear next step, and the momentum that comes from actually taking it.We work in a six-session arc, usually over about three months:

  • Session 1 is about you: where you're at, what's working, what isn't, and what you want from our time together.

  • In each of sessions 2 to 5, you choose a topic, we dig in, and we land on one action step plus one small piece of homework.

  • Session 6 closes the arc. We look back at where you started, name what's changed, and decide what you'll carry forward.

  • Between sessions, the system keeps things moving. Before each session, I'll email you a short nudge asking what you want to bring. An hour after, you'll get a summary of where we landed and a look ahead to next time.
